Good Vibrations Hosts OhMiBod's bluMotion Launch Party

SAN FRANCISCO — Good Vibrations, the iconic San Francisco-based sex toy retailer, announced an in-store product launch of OhMiBod’s blueMotion vibrator at its Palo Alto store in the heart of Silicon Valley.

As part of its mission to promote sexual health and education, the evening will include a Q&A discussion, “New Intimacy in a Connected World,” with OhMiBod co-founder Brian Dunham and Good Vibrations staff sexologist, Dr. Carol Queen.

blueMotion is a wearable vibrator that features innovative technology designed to allow couples to experience intimacy across long distances. Through OhMiBod’s Wi-Fi enabled Remote App, partners can control the vibrator with their smartphone.

“We are so excited to offer the newest example out-of-the-box vibratory thinking that our friends at OhMiBod bring to everything they do,” Dr. Queen said. “This app-enabled vibe lets people stay close and get frisky no matter how far from one another they are, and we know our customers have been waiting a long time for the promise of ‘teledildonics' to come to fruition.”

Attendees will receive an “insider’s look” at blueMotion from ideation to creation, as well as have the opportunity to test the technology at one of several stations using iPads equipped with the OhMiBod App, Skype and GChat.

Participants will also have the chance to win one of six blueMotion vibrators being raffled every 30 minutes. Light hors d’oeuvres and beverages will be provided throughout the evening.

“We’re really in the 21st century now,” Dr. Queen said.   

blueMotion Launch Party will take place at Good Vibrations located on534 Ramona St., Palo Alto, Calif. (between University & Hamilton) on Thursday, July 31, from 7-9 p.m.
